Job Summary
In this role, you will manage the technical configuration and development of the CAFM system, conduct training sessions, generate reports, and collaborate with IT and external partners to resolve issues.
Your role in the team
- As an IT Technician in the Technical Department, you are responsible for the technical support and configuration of access control, as well as for the maintenance, further development, and programming of the CAFM system used at the hospital.
- Your responsibilities include creating reports and data queries, conducting user training, troubleshooting in collaboration with the IT department and external system partners, as well as supporting quality management in the technical area and in the accredited and certified sectors of the hospital.
